Beaumont Emergency Hospital is a leading healthcare facility located at 4004 College Street, Beaumont, Texas. Renowned for its commitment to providing prompt, efficient, and compassionate emergency medical care, this hospital has been setting the standard in emergency services for over eight years. Beaumont Emergency Hospital specializes in offering the same high-quality medical services found at traditional hospital emergency rooms but addresses the common challenges associated with hospital-based ERs, such as long wait times and overcrowding. Job Duties

  • Greet all patients, visitors, and vendors with professionalism
  • Facilitate the registration and admissions process ensuring accuracy and completeness
  • Verify insurance and collect co-pays or payments according to hospital policies
  • Scan documents into the electronic health record (EHR) system
  • Answer and route phone calls promptly and professionally
  • Perform daily tasks to support efficient front desk operations
  • Reconcile financial logs and cash ledger, making deposits as necessary
